Career path

Marine Conservation Careers: UK Job Market Outlook

Explore the thriving UK marine conservation job market with our insightful overview. This dynamic field offers diverse career paths, each playing a vital role in safeguarding our oceans.

Role Description
Marine Conservation Officer Develop and implement conservation strategies, monitor marine ecosystems, and engage in policy advocacy. High demand for strong ecological understanding and communication skills.
Marine Biologist (Research) Conduct crucial research on marine life, ecosystems, and conservation challenges. Requires advanced scientific skills and a dedication to data analysis and publication.
Marine Policy Analyst Analyze policy impacts on marine environments, advising governments and organizations. Strong analytical and communication skills are vital for this policy-focused role.
Marine Conservation Education Specialist Educate the public and stakeholders on conservation issues. Strong communication, educational and outreach experience are key requirements.
